- Captain Tsubasa is also a synonym for the unreleased Tecmo Cup game for the Sega Mega Drive (not to be confused with Tecmo World Cup '92) due to its similarities (it started out as a Famicom game starring the characters here in Japan).
Captain Tsubasa |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
System(s): Sega Mega CD | |||||
Publisher: Tecmo | |||||
Developer: Tecmo | |||||
Genre: Sports/Simulation | |||||
Number of players: 1-2 | |||||

Captain Tsubasa is a football game for the Sega Mega CD based on the anime of the same name.
